Turning Lemons Into Lemonade

 

 


You will never be the perfect entrepreneur. No matter how hard you work to avoid catastrophes... at some point, disasters will happen. At times, you will look bad, and your reputation will be injured. But, that doesn't mean you or your company have to suffer long-term repercussions because of it.

Here are some steps for embracing your own humanity, and turning "bad" situations into incredible, marketing situations.

Step 1- Laugh at yourself and your mistakes. (Getting upset about the situation won't fix things. Look at this as an opportunity instead.)

Step 2- Fix the disaster, tenaciously.

Step 3- Offer the injured customers or prospects even more than they expect. (If done properly, these individuals may become your biggest fans.)

Step 4- Use the situation to fix your current systems. (Making a mistake is alright. Repeating that mistake can be devastating.)

Step 5- Freely share these experiences in marketing messages, blogs, webinars, or as a "reason" to have another sale or promotion.

People are generally more forgiving than they seem. If you are willing to "expose" your weaknesses, your contacts will feel your honesty and sincerity. The harder you try to be the "perfect" small business owner (and hide your errors), the more detached from your contacts you become. And, the more likely they are to mistrust you.

Enjoy your imperfections and learn to use them to your advantage!

Chicago Wedding Photographer – 10 Tips on How to Evaluate Your Options

Chicago Wedding Photographer – 10 Tips on How to Evaluate Your Options

When searching for the perfect wedding photographer for your special day, especially if you are getting married in a big city like Chicago, the many choices you have can be overwhelming. How do you find the right one?

The most important thing you can do is set up a face-to-face appointment so that you can personally meet your candidate. When searching for a Chicago wedding photographer, it is likely you will come across many big companies. If you are not clear and specific about your request to meet the actual photographer who will be behind the camera at your wedding, these giants may have you speak with a sales representative or album designer instead. If you are looking for a more personal experience, you should direct your attention to the smaller studios. However, make sure the studio has been in business for at least a few years: you don’t want a new studio to fail and close in the current economy after you have them booked for your wedding, leaving you high and dry on your big day, or even after your wedding.

Once you’ve double-checked that you are meeting with your actual photographer, make sure you ask him or her to show you a portfolio of their work. Evaluating the pictures the photographer has under the belt is the best way to make sure he or she has experience and a style that matches your own. But don’t stop after looking at five or six of the best images, check all the shots from at least three full weddings the photographer has worked. You want your Chicago wedding photographer to show skill at taking beautiful photos throughout your big day from start to finish, not one that just lucked out with a few great shots. A photographer with true talent will be able to capture the life and beauty of even a mundane moment. Look for good photos under varied lighting, a variety of interesting angles, and an eye for detail.

Another good idea is to ask to see albums of your Chicago wedding photographer’s most recent weddings. You don’t want a photographer showing you photos from years ago, with nothing current in his or her portfolio. An experienced photographer’s portfolio should also include shots from all four seasons, so you can look at the photos he or she has taken during the specific month of your wedding. You can bring some photos you like and show the photographers, but it’s really up to you to evaluate his or her style to make sure it matches your vision.

After looking through the candidate photographer’s portfolio, you should have picked up some good ideas on different types of flowers, arrangements, shoot locations, and even hair styles you may want to incorporate into your own wedding.

Many brides today actually hire two photographers: one to focus on the storytelling and interaction between the bride and groom, and the other to focus on the photojournalism that encompasses spontaneous moments, exchanges and little details that will give your album a more personal touch. Emotions happen in split seconds, and two cameras will give you more points of view and the best coverage to really tell the story. However, if your budget only allows for one photographer, he or she should be able to flow between the two roles, efficiently shooting some posed photos and unobtrusively capturing the natural moments. Whatever you decide, make sure the Chicago wedding photographer you choose has back-up equipment and a back-up photographer who could shoot your wedding in case of an emergency.

Make sure the studio you decide to work with can provide you with digital negatives of your photos. Find out if they just shoot and burn the photos, or if they take the time to go through them over a several days and apply special features to enhance the quality of the photos. Instead of leaving the images plain, a good photographer will look for the potential behind the straight shot. Some sample techniques your Chicago wedding photographer should be familiar with include creating a vintage look and applying various filters to stylize your images in the likes of the latest Twilight or 300 movies. Make sure the studio you choose can provide finished albums in the style you want. Some examples include coffee table books, magazine style, or the always popular traditional method books.

Before ending the meeting, ask for referrals. With so many weddings happening in the windy city every year, your Chicago wedding photographer should have no problem giving you a list.

After you’ve met your photographer and spoken with a few past customers, tune into your intuition and consider your feelings. Do you think he or she is the right person for the job? Finding your Joomla Template Positions

In Joomla there is a hidden core function which once activated displays a layer on a Joomla website which shows you exactly the template positions currently used.

To activate this function you just need to add ?tp=1 to the end of your current Joomla address. As an example take a look at the following link:http://www.dart-creations.com?tp=1 As you can see, you can know see all the positions which are template makes use of. You can use this on any Joomla version, on any Joomla site and on any Joomla page (though you might need to use &tp=1). The following parameters can be used: 

  • ?tp=1 (for horizontal view)
  • ?tp=-1 (for no wrapper niew)
  • ?tp=0 (for normal view - no view of positions)

Thumbnail creation from FLV using ffmpeg

seek to the middle of the file an output a JPEG
 
 
<?php
 function GetFLVDuration($file){
  // get contents of a file into a string
  if(file_exists($file)){
   $handle = fopen($file, "r");
   $contents = fread($handle, filesize($file));
   fclose($handle);
  
   if(strlen($contents) > 3){
    if(substr($contents,0 , 3) == "FLV"){
     $taglen = hexdec(bin2hex(substr($contents, strlen($contents)-3)));
     if(strlen($contents) > $taglen){
      $duration = hexdec(bin2hex(substr($contents, strlen($contents) - $taglen, 3)));
      return $duration;
     }
    }
   }
  }
  return 0;
 }
 
 // get duration and divide by 2 to get middle
 $duration = number_format((GetFLVDuration('output.flv') / 1000) / 2);
 
 // check for error
 if($duration<0){
  $duration = 0;
 }
 
 //save out thumbnail
 $output2 = exec('ffmpeg -y -i output.flv -r 1 -vframes 1 -sameq -f image2 -ss ' . $duration . ' -an output.jpg');
?>
-----------------
 
To improve quality, try increasing the frame rate via the -r option:

 $output = exec ("ffmpeg -i source.ext -s qvga -r 24 -ab 128 -y output.flv");

or

 $output = exec ("ffmpeg -i source.ext -s qvga -r 30 -ab 128 -y output.flv");

Below is a solution to finding the total number of frames in a file, which you could use to determine the middle frame:

http://lists.mplayerhq.hu/pipermail/ffmpeg-user/2006-August/003884.html (Note that the language is not PHP, but you should be able to get the general idea).

XAMPP Apache port change

1. Find httpd.conf file in the folder path C:\xampp\apache\conf\ 

2. Open httpd.conf file in your text editor.

3.Find this line:
Listen 80

change it to:
Listen 8009

4.Save and restart Apache.

http://locahost:8009 would now be your XAMPP default pages.

What are CSS sprites?

css-sprites-lead.png


CSS sprites are a way to reduce the number of HTTP requests made for image resources referenced by your site. Images are combined into one larger image at defined X and Y coorindates. Having assigned this generated image to relevant page elements the background-position CSS property can then be used to shift the visible area to the required component image.

This technique can be very effective for improving site performance, particularly in situations where many small images, such as menu icons, are used. The Yahoo! home page, for example, employs the technique for exactly this


Further Reading

A List Apart published an article entitled CSS Sprites: Image Slicing's Kiss of Death which explains the concepts behind CSS sprites. If you're new to this technique we'd strongly suggest heading over to A List Apart and taking a look.
